Three cruise ships came in on the day we disembarked. LAX airport was a zoo. Although many pax had different departure times, the cruise line transfer buses, all the taxis, shuttles, and vans descended on the airport at the same time. The check-in lines, check-in luggage lines, and the security lines were something like we had never seen before. Took us almost 2 hours to get to the departure gate.
